Farmers protest at Delhi’s Jantar Mantar, break barricades

The protest by wrestlers at Delhi’s Jantar Mantar continued for the 16th day on Monday. A batch of farmers from Punjab reached Jantar Mantar on Monday. The farmers raised slogans after reaching Jantar Mantar. It is alleged that the protesters broke the police barricades and reached the protest site and created a ruckus.

After this, some videos are also going viral on social media in which the protesters are allegedly using anti-government and derogatory words for PM Modi.

The protest is being held against BJP MP and Wrestling Association of India president Brij Bhushan Sharan Singh, accused of sexual harassment. Earlier, the wrestlers demanded that an FIR be lodged against Brij Bhushan Singh, now the farmers have gathered here in support of the wrestlers and are protesting demanding arrest.
